Preparation Phase & Tools to Use
To bring this spectacular dish to life, a couple of key tools come in handy. First and foremost, a food processor is invaluable for achieving that light, fluffy ricotta. If you don’t have one, a hand mixer works too, though it may take a bit more effort. A baking dish is essential for roasting those delightful strawberries, letting their flavors meld and intensify in the oven. Lastly, a quality baking sheet produces that perfect crunch on your toasted bread.
Essential Preparation Tips
- Always preheat your oven before starting to roast the strawberries. This ensures even cooking and perfect caramelization.
- Choose rustic bread with a hearty crust to contrast the softness of the whipped ricotta and roasted strawberries.
- Fresh thyme is more than a garnish; it adds a layer of aromatic complexity. Don’t skip it!
Ingredients for Roasted Strawberry Whipped Ricotta Toast
- 1 pound strawberries: Look for fragrant berries. If strawberries are out of season, try raspberries or blueberries for different but equally delicious flavors.
- 2 tablespoons honey: This enhances the natural sweetness of the strawberries. Maple syrup or agave makes a great substitute if you prefer.
- Juice of 1/2 lemon: Fresh lemon juice brightens the flavors. Lime can also work in a pinch.
- 4 sprigs fresh thyme: Fresh herbs elevate the flavor profile. Dried thyme can be a substitute in a pinch, though the freshness will be less potent.
- 2 slices rustic bread, 1-inch thick: Look for a good sourdough or country-style loaf. This adds a delightful crunch when toasted.
- 1 tablespoon olive oil: This helps to toast the bread and adds depth of flavor.
- 3/4 cup whole milk ricotta cheese: Whole milk ricotta yields a richer texture. You can swap it for low-fat or even whipped cream cheese if desired.
- Pinch of sea salt: Just a bit enhances all the flavors in this dish.
How to Make Roasted Strawberry Whipped Ricotta Toast
Step-by-Step Instructions
-
Preheat the Oven: Set your oven to 400°F (200°C). This ensures a hot environment for the strawberries to roast beautifully.
-
Prep the Strawberries: In a medium baking dish, toss the ends-removed strawberries with honey, a generous squeeze of lemon juice, and scatter thyme sprigs on top, allowing the flavors to meld.
-
Roast: Place in the oven and roast for 20 minutes, stirring gently halfway through. The strawberries should be soft, syrupy, and ready to enchant your taste buds. Remove from the oven and let them cool slightly.
-
Toast the Bread: Drizzle olive oil over the slices of rustic bread, then place them on a baking sheet. Toast in the oven for about 1 minute, until lightly golden and crisp.
-
Whip the Ricotta: In your food processor, add the ricotta cheese. Pulse for 30 seconds to 1 minute until it reaches a light, fluffy consistency. This step creates that dreamy texture that makes your toast irresistible.
-
Assemble: Spread the whipped ricotta generously over the warm toast. Next, spoon the luscious roasted strawberries and their juices atop. Don’t forget to garnish with lovely thyme leaves and a pinch of sea salt for that flavor pop. Serve immediately to enjoy the warm ensemble while the bread holds its crunch.
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ips
- Make-Ahead: You can roast the strawberries ahead of time and store them in the fridge. Reheat them for a few moments or enjoy cold for a refreshing experience.
- Cooking Alternatives: For a quicker method, consider using an air fryer to roast the strawberries, adjusting time and temperature as needed. You can also use a stovetop grill for the bread instead of the oven.
- Customization Ideas: Feel free to experiment with toppings! Add slices of banana, a sprinkle of nuts, or even a drizzle of balsamic reduction for an elevated twist.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Though straightforward, there are pitfalls to watch out for. First, don’t choose strawberries that are overly ripe, as they may disintegrate when roasted rather than remaining tender. Also, avoid over-toasting the bread; it should be golden and crisp without being hard. Lastly, remember to let the roasted strawberries cool slightly before serving to allow the flavors to deepen and to prevent burns.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. The bread will soften, so it’s best to keep the strawberries separate when storing. For reheating, pop the toast in a toaster or a broiler to crisp it up before adding the strawberries and ricotta again.
If you wish to freeze it, especially the roasted strawberries, place them in a freezer-safe bag for up to 2 months. Rewarm in the oven or microwave before serving, but know that texture may slightly change with freezing.

FAQs
Can I use frozen strawberries instead?
Absolutely! Frozen strawberries work well, though they might release more moisture during roasting. Just add a touch more honey to balance the flavors.
What can I substitute for ricotta?
Cream cheese or Greek yogurt offers a different yet delicious twist. Consider which one fits best with your flavor palette!
How do I prolong the freshness of strawberries?
Store strawberries unwashed in the fridge, allowing them to breathe and maintain their firm texture. Rinse them only just before use.
Is this recipe suitable for vegans?
You can easily make a vegan version by substituting ricotta with a plant-based alternative, like cashew cheese or coconut yogurt.
Can I make this dish gluten-free?
Certainly! Choose gluten-free bread to keep this delightful toast accessible to all.

Roasted Strawberry Whipped Ricotta Toast
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 2 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A delightful blend of roasted strawberries and whipped ricotta on crispy rustic toast, perfect for brunch or a light dessert.
Ingredients
- 1 pound strawberries
- 2 tablespoons honey
- Juice of 1/2 lemon
- 4 sprigs fresh thyme
- 2 slices rustic bread, 1-inch thick
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 3/4 cup whole milk ricotta cheese
- Pinch of sea salt
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
- Prep the strawberries by tossing them with honey, lemon juice, and thyme in a baking dish.
- Roast the strawberries for 20 minutes, stirring halfway through.
- Toast the bread slices in the oven for about 1 minute until golden.
- Whip the ricotta in a food processor for 30 seconds to 1 minute until fluffy.
- Assemble the toast by spreading the whipped ricotta and topping with roasted strawberries and a pinch of sea salt. Serve immediately.
Notes
For make-ahead, roast strawberries in advance and store them in the fridge. Reheat before serving.
